RETIREMENT and HOUSING


Upon retirement, we plan to sell our house and buy a smaller house.
1. Should we invest the proceeds (equity) in the stock market and apply for a mortgage to buy the smaller house?
Currently, my APR is 2.99% and the probability of getting the same APR or slightly higher (3.49%) is 85%.

2. Or should we use the proceeds to outright buy the house?

Right now, the option to stay in the house is not so appealing despite the low APR.
1. Too many bedrooms and bathrooms to clean;
2. Summer - Almost 2 hours to mow the grass (I have no riding mower) and weed out the flower garden;
3. Winter – shoveling snow is a pain in the back even with a snow removal machine
4. Winter gas and summer electric bill, $400/month (spring and fall seasons is between $180.00-$240.00);
5. Taxes $8300 per annum (school, county and township);
6. Home insurance –not too bad $1100.00 per annum.
